
为了准确评估和优化数据库系统的效能,业界广泛采用标准化的基准测试工具,其中TPCC(Transaction Processing Performance Councils Benchmark C)作为衡量OLTP(Online Transaction Processing)系统性能的金标准,尤为重要
本文将深入探讨如何高效下载与部署TPCC-MySQL,为构建一个全面、可靠的数据库性能测试环境提供详尽指南
一、TPCC-MySQL简介:为何选择它? TPCC基准测试模拟了一个复杂的零售环境,涵盖了订单管理、库存管理、顾客信息管理、配送管理等核心业务操作,通过模拟大量并发用户执行这些操作来评估数据库系统的吞吐量、响应时间等关键性能指标
TPCC因其贴近真实业务场景、测试全面而被广泛应用于数据库系统的性能测试中
MySQL作为开源关系型数据库管理系统,凭借其高性能、易用性和广泛的社区支持,在全球拥有庞大的用户基础
将TPCC应用于MySQL,不仅能够准确反映MySQL在实际业务场景下的表现,还能帮助开发者、DBA(数据库管理员)以及系统架构师识别并解决潜在的性能瓶颈
二、高效下载TPCC-MySQL:步骤详解 1.准备工作 -环境要求:确保你的测试机器已安装MySQL数据库服务器,版本建议为最新的稳定版
同时,操作系统需支持MySQL的运行,如Linux、Windows等
-工具准备:虽然TPCC没有官方的MySQL实现版本,但社区提供了多种开源实现,如Percona的sysbench中的TPCC测试模块,或是直接通过GitHub等平台搜索到的第三方TPCC测试工具
2.选择并下载TPCC工具 -Percona sysbench:推荐从Percona官网下载最新版本的sysbench,因为它内置了TPCC测试模块,易于使用且维护活跃
-访问Percona官网,导航至下载页面
- 根据操作系统选择合适的安装包(如.deb、.rpm或源码包)
- 按照官方文档安装sysbench
-第三方工具:若寻求更多自定义功能或特定需求,可在GitHub等平台上搜索TPCC-MySQL相关项目,查看项目文档,选择适合的版本进行下载
3.安装与配置 -sysbench安装示例(以Linux为例): bash wget https://repo.percona.com/yum/percona-release-latest.noarch.rpm sudo rpm -ivh percona-release-latest.noarch.rpm sudo yum install sysbench -配置MySQL:确保MySQL数据库已正确配置,包括内存分配、日志文件位置等,
Contos系统:轻松卸载MySQL教程
TPCC-MySQL 下载指南:轻松获取性能测试工具
MySQL批量数据校验技巧揭秘
Win8系统下MySQL安装指南
MySQL CASE WHEN语句应用技巧
MySQL高效执行UPDATE操作技巧
Java连接MySQL乱码解决方案
Win8系统下MySQL安装指南
服务器切换MySQL数据库指南
MySQL数据同比分析实战指南
MySQL远程连接故障排查指南
《MySQL权威指南PDF》深度解读
Ubuntu配置MySQL远程连接指南
MySQL锁表未释放:排查与解决指南
MySQL5.6重启命令操作指南
MySQL导出数据为TXT文件指南
MySQL主从复制实战指南
MySQL数据库添加SPL功能指南
MySQL6.0启动指南:轻松打开步骤